How to Make Mountain Dew Cheesecake with Dorito Crust
-
Prepare the crust: In a bowl, mix the crushed Nacho Cheese Doritos with melted unsalted butter until well combined. The mixture should resemble wet sand.
-
Form the crust: Press the Dorito mixture firmly into the bottom of a cheesecake pan. Aim for an even layer that covers the base completely for a deliciously crunchy foundation.
-
Make the syrup: Pour 3 cups of Mountain Dew into a saucepan and simmer on medium heat. Stir occasionally, cooking until it reduces to about 1 cup of syrup. Let it cool before using.
-
Blend ingredients: In a mixing bowl, combine the softened cream cheese, sour cream, and salt. Blend until smooth and creamy, ensuring no lumps remain for that perfect texture.
-
Mix in Mountain Dew: Add the cooled, reduced Mountain Dew syrup to the cream cheese mixture. Stir well to incorporate all the flavors harmoniously.
-
Add eggs: Crack room temperature eggs one at a time into the mixture, stirring well after each addition. This helps achieve a lusciously rich filling.
-
Color it green (optional): If you want a fun pop of color, add 4 drops of green food coloring and mix until fully integrated. Your cheesecake will look vibrant and inviting!
-
Combine filling and crust: Carefully pour the cheesecake filling over the prepared Dorito crust, smoothing the top with a spatula for even baking.
-
Bake it: Place in a preheated oven at 325°F and bake until set, which usually takes about 1 hour. The edges should firm up while the center remains slightly wobbly.
-
Cool and refrigerate: Once baked, allow the cheesecake to cool at room temperature. Then, refrigerate for at least 4 hours (or overnight) before serving for the best flavor.
Optional: Top with a sprinkle of crushed Doritos for an extra crunch before serving!

How to Store and Freeze Mountain Dew Cheesecake with Dorito Crust
Fridge: Store your Mountain Dew Cheesecake with Dorito Crust in an airtight container for up to 5 days to keep it fresh and delicious.
Freezer: Wrap individual slices in plastic wrap, then foil, and freeze for up to 3 months. Be sure to label them for easy identification!
Thawing: For best results, thaw frozen slices in the fridge overnight before enjoying. This helps retain the creamy texture and wonderful flavors.
Reheating: If you prefer a warm or slightly softened cheesecake, let it s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es before serving. Enjoy!
Expert Tips for Mountain Dew Cheesecake with Dorito Crust
Crust Consistency: Ensure the Dorito crust mixture resembles wet sand; too dry will result in a crumbly base.
Egg Temperature Matters: Always use room temperature eggs to create a smooth filling. This prevents a lumpy cheesecake.
Reducing Mountain Dew: Simmer your Mountain Dew slowly to avoid burning it. The right reduction is key for enhancing the flavor.
Cooling Time: Be patient and allow the cheesecake to cool fully before refrigerating. This prevents cracks and ensures a perfect set.
Baking Watch: Keep an eye on the cheesecake, as ovens can vary. It’s done when the edges are set, and the center has a slight jiggle.

What if my cheesecake cracks while baking?
That can happen, but don’t worry too much! Cracks usually result from the cheesecake being baked at too high a temperature or not cooling properly. To avoid this, keep an eye on it while baking and allow it to cool gradually at room temperature before refrigerating. If it does crack, simply cover it with toppings when serving!
